Impact Litigation Grants
Offered by The Impact Fund · Berkeley, CA
About this opportunity
The Impact Fund awards recoverable grants to legal services nonprofits, private attorneys, and small law firms pursuing impact litigation on economic, environmental, racial, and social justice issues. Grants are awarded four times per year, typically ranging from $10,000 to $50,000, to support cases that confront systemic injustice and advance civil rights.
